Abstract
The paper presents a new algorithm for blocking artifacts reduction in low bit rate video. The algorithm addresses the blocking effect on block boundaries, as well as the one inside the blocks. The algorithm works with variety of coding schemes, and does not exploit any information from the coded bitstream. It has extremely low complexity and it is designed to work on a mobile platform in real time. It incorporates two parts: artifacts detection procedure, which decides whether the processing is required for the particular location in the video frame, and artifacts reduction procedure, which performs the actual filtering depending on local image characteristics. The experiments confirm the algorithms effectiveness, as well as its low computational complexity.
